IMPORTANT NOTE: The conference will be held in Druskininkai, not in Vilnius. Do not be confused by the name of the conference hotel (SPA VILNIUS), which operates in several Lithuanian towns.
Druskininkai is a touristic town, therefore there are many accommodation options for every budget. Make sure to book your accommodation well in advance, as summer is the peak tourist season in Druskininkai. The guests are most welcome to treat themselves with a relaxing stay at a minimum distance from the session halls, that is, in the 4-star hotel SPA VILNIUS Druskininkai (within the conference venue complex). Accommodation here is child-friendly and by default includes a superb breakfast, access to the pool and sauna complex, movement therapy, exercise equipment, and parking. Meanwhile, for outdoors enthusiasts, it is also possible to camp at the 4-star Druskininkai campsite, a 10-minute walk from the conference venue and the BBQ evening location. Here you can stay either in your own tent or camper, or rent an in-place camper, and pets are allowed. There is also a café-restaurant with an Armenian chef in place for your convenience.
